BatchJobStatistics interface

Estatísticas de uso de recursos para um trabalho.

Propriedades

failedTasksCount

O número total de Tarefas no Trabalho que falharam durante o intervalo de tempo dado. Uma tarefa falha se esgotar o seu número máximo de tentativas sem devolver o código de saída 0.

kernelCpuTime

O tempo total de CPU em modo kernel (somado por todos os núcleos e todos os Nós de Computação) consumido por todas as Tarefas no Trabalho. A duração do tempo está especificada no formato ISO 8601.

lastUpdateTime

A data em que as estatísticas foram atualizadas pela última vez. Todas as estatísticas estão limitadas ao intervalo entre startTime e lastUpdateTime.

readIoGiB

A quantidade total de dados em GiB lidos do disco por todas as Tarefas no Trabalho.

readIops

O número total de operações de leitura de disco realizadas por todas as Tarefas no Trabalho.

startTime

A hora de início do intervalo temporal coberto pelas estatísticas.

succeededTasksCount

O número total de Tarefas concluídas com sucesso no Trabalho durante o intervalo de tempo indicado. Uma tarefa é concluída com sucesso se devolver o código de saída 0.

taskRetriesCount

O número total de tentativas em todas as Tarefas do Trabalho durante o intervalo de tempo dado.

url

O URL das estatísticas.

userCpuTime

O tempo total de CPU em modo utilizador (somado em todos os núcleos e todos os Nós de Computação) consumido por todas as Tarefas do Trabalho. A duração do tempo está especificada no formato ISO 8601.

waitTime

O tempo total de espera de todas as tarefas do trabalho. O tempo de espera para uma tarefa é definido como o tempo decorrido entre a criação da tarefa e o início da execução da tarefa. (Se a tarefa for retentada devido a falhas, o tempo de espera é o tempo até à execução da tarefa mais recente.) Este valor é apenas reportado nas estatísticas de vida útil da conta; não está incluído nas estatísticas do Emprego. A duração do tempo está especificada no formato ISO 8601.

wallClockTime

O tempo total do relógio de parede de todas as Tarefas no Trabalho. O tempo do relógio de parede é o tempo decorrido desde que a Tarefa começou a ser executada num Nó de Computação até ao seu término (ou até à última vez que as estatísticas foram atualizadas, se a Tarefa não tivesse terminado nessa altura). Se uma Tarefa fosse repetida, isto inclui o tempo de parede de todas as tentativas de Tarefa. A duração do tempo está especificada no formato ISO 8601.

writeIoGiB

A quantidade total de dados em GiB escritos no disco por todas as Tarefas no Trabalho.

writeIops

O número total de operações de escrita em disco realizadas por todas as Tarefas no Trabalho.

Detalhes de Propriedade

failedTasksCount

O número total de Tarefas no Trabalho que falharam durante o intervalo de tempo dado. Uma tarefa falha se esgotar o seu número máximo de tentativas sem devolver o código de saída 0.

failedTasksCount: string

Valor de Propriedade

string

kernelCpuTime

O tempo total de CPU em modo kernel (somado por todos os núcleos e todos os Nós de Computação) consumido por todas as Tarefas no Trabalho. A duração do tempo está especificada no formato ISO 8601.

kernelCpuTime: string

Valor de Propriedade

string

lastUpdateTime

A data em que as estatísticas foram atualizadas pela última vez. Todas as estatísticas estão limitadas ao intervalo entre startTime e lastUpdateTime.

lastUpdateTime: Date

Valor de Propriedade

Date

readIoGiB

A quantidade total de dados em GiB lidos do disco por todas as Tarefas no Trabalho.

readIoGiB: number

Valor de Propriedade

number

readIops

O número total de operações de leitura de disco realizadas por todas as Tarefas no Trabalho.

readIops: string

Valor de Propriedade

string

startTime

A hora de início do intervalo temporal coberto pelas estatísticas.

startTime: Date

Valor de Propriedade

Date

succeededTasksCount

O número total de Tarefas concluídas com sucesso no Trabalho durante o intervalo de tempo indicado. Uma tarefa é concluída com sucesso se devolver o código de saída 0.

succeededTasksCount: string

Valor de Propriedade

string

taskRetriesCount

O número total de tentativas em todas as Tarefas do Trabalho durante o intervalo de tempo dado.

taskRetriesCount: string

Valor de Propriedade

string

url

O URL das estatísticas.

url: string

Valor de Propriedade

string

userCpuTime

O tempo total de CPU em modo utilizador (somado em todos os núcleos e todos os Nós de Computação) consumido por todas as Tarefas do Trabalho. A duração do tempo está especificada no formato ISO 8601.

userCpuTime: string

Valor de Propriedade

string

waitTime

O tempo total de espera de todas as tarefas do trabalho. O tempo de espera para uma tarefa é definido como o tempo decorrido entre a criação da tarefa e o início da execução da tarefa. (Se a tarefa for retentada devido a falhas, o tempo de espera é o tempo até à execução da tarefa mais recente.) Este valor é apenas reportado nas estatísticas de vida útil da conta; não está incluído nas estatísticas do Emprego. A duração do tempo está especificada no formato ISO 8601.

waitTime: string

Valor de Propriedade

string

wallClockTime

O tempo total do relógio de parede de todas as Tarefas no Trabalho. O tempo do relógio de parede é o tempo decorrido desde que a Tarefa começou a ser executada num Nó de Computação até ao seu término (ou até à última vez que as estatísticas foram atualizadas, se a Tarefa não tivesse terminado nessa altura). Se uma Tarefa fosse repetida, isto inclui o tempo de parede de todas as tentativas de Tarefa. A duração do tempo está especificada no formato ISO 8601.

wallClockTime: string

Valor de Propriedade

string

writeIoGiB

A quantidade total de dados em GiB escritos no disco por todas as Tarefas no Trabalho.

writeIoGiB: number

Valor de Propriedade

number

writeIops

O número total de operações de escrita em disco realizadas por todas as Tarefas no Trabalho.

writeIops: string

Valor de Propriedade

string